  1. Mdm2 E3 Ligase Inhibitor

    MEL24 is an inhibitor of the Mdm2 E3 ligase, which plays a critical role in regulating p53 protein levels. This compound significantly reduces cell survival and enhances sensitivity to DNA-damaging agents in a p53-dependent manner. MEL24 is primarily utilized in antitumor research, contributing to studies aimed at understanding and overcoming resistance in cancer therapies.
  2. MDM2 Ligand

    (rel)-Nutlin carboxylic acid is an MDM2 ligand derived from Nutlin 3, targeting the MDM2 protein to inhibit its interaction with p53. This compound plays a crucial role in cancer research, particularly in the study of p53 pathway modulation and potential therapeutic interventions. It can also be utilized in the development of PROTACs when linked to other proteins, facilitating targeted protein degradation.
  3. MDM2 E3 Ligase Inhibitor

    MEL23 is an MDM2 E3 ligase inhibitor that specifically targets the E3 ligase activity of the MDM2-MDMX complex. This compound effectively inhibits the ubiquitination of MDM2 and p53, leading to decreased viability in cells expressing wild-type p53. Additionally, MEL23 stabilizes MDM2 through a mechanism that does not involve p53 transcription, making it a valuable tool for research into cancer biology and therapeutic strategies targeting the p53 pathway.
